How do you find a leak in a full foam hot tub?

On spas with foam-filled cabinets, dig away the soggy foam until you find the leak source. Another method is to fill your hot tub (with the power off) and let the water drop. Once the water stops draining, examine jets and parts just above the new water level for leaks.

What is hot tub defoamer?

Defoamer is designed to eliminate foaming in spas, hot tubs, fountains and swimming pools. Foam is usually caused by soaps, oils, lotions, and cosmetics that are introduced into the hot tub during each use. When you turn the jets on this will agitate the foam causing contaminants and cause the foaming to occur.

  • How to find a leak in your hot tub?

    Start by turning off the power to the hot tub.

  • Access the equipment compartment by removing the side panels and look for any signs of leaks or dampness.
  • Inspect all pipes,fittings,as well as the pressure switch.
  • Adding a dark food coloring to the water can help you identify a leak,as water seeks the path of least resistance.
